11, which is what I expected.  But I changed the byte value to 16 (because I 
was having trouble getting single digit hex values working in the command) and 
sent this command:
>>> for x in range(0,500):
        
ep.write(b'\x16\xFF\xFF\xFF\xFF\xFF\xFF\xFF\xFF\xFF\xFF\xFF\xFF\xFF\xFF\xFF\xFF')

it respond with 500 17's and prints a black bar!  So it looks like whatever 
concern you had with using encode was coming to fruition.

> 
>       That's the easy one -- \x in a string introduces an 8-bit byte value
> 
> -- so only two hex digits well be read. The "A" is interpreted as
> 
> regular text.

Interesting, so what if I only wanted to send 4bits as a hex value?  Also can I 
somehow throw in some binary alongside of hex?  At some point in my program I'm 
going to need to send some commands preferably in hex along with the binary 
image data.
